Third Sector, Community and Practice Fund Launched
The National Centre for Resilience has launched its new Third Sector, Community and Practice Fund, with grants of up to £15,000 available. Open to community groups, practitioners and third sector organisations, the fund’s theme is “Building Resilience to Natural Hazards through Local Community and Place-Based Approaches”. The deadline for applications is Wednesday 31st January 2024.

Pension Age Winter Heating Payment Consultation
Scottish Government has launched a new consultation on the introduction of a new benefit to help older people with fuel costs, and are seeking people’s views. The Pension Age Winter Heating Payment aims to replace the UK Government’s Winter Fuel Payment in Scotland. The deadline for responses is Monday 15th January 2024.

Strathcarron Hospice Trialling VR Equipment with Patients in the Community
Last year, Strathcarron Hospice received £10,000 from Grangemouth Rotary Club to purchase Virtual Reality (VR) technology, which many patients within the Hospice’s In-Patient Unit have been able to use. The VR headset is now being trialled with Strathcarron patients in their homes across local communities.
